Pepperdine Executive MBA Ranked Number 21 in Nation by Fortune Magazine


Pepperdine Graziadio Business School's Executive MBA programs, which include the unique Presidents and Key Executives (PKE) MBA, was named number 21 in the US by Fortune magazine in its inaugural ranking of executive MBA programs. The Pepperdine Graziadio Executive MBA is recognized for its brand, admission selectivity, work experience of incoming students (15 years), and the number of Graziadio alumni (all programs) who are c-suite executives at Fortune 1000 companies.

"Pepperdine Graziadio's Executive MBA programs are renowned for focusing on strategy and mastering the nuances of business that have evolved over time and will be vital for the future," said Deryck van Rensburg, dean, Pepperdine Graziadio Business School. "We are pleased, but not at all surprised given our long history as one of the first executive programs, to be named among the top in the nation."

Pepperdine Graziadio's Executive MBA (EMBA) teaches current managers and executives to be strong and effective leaders in the modern business world. In addition to training through coursework during the 19-month program, each small, collaborative cohort benefits from a network of peers from across industry sectors that lend experience, best practices, and new perspectives. Classes meet on Friday or Saturday. Each cohort is assigned a class advisor who acts as a mentor and offers guidance to students as they complete their degrees. The Presidents and Key Executives MBA program is a one-of-a-kind MBA strategically designed to challenge top-level executives charged with strategic decision-making and bottom-line results. The PKE MBA is the only degree program in the world designed for senior, c-suite executives and entrepreneurial business owners. Throughout the 15-month experience, executives from diverse industry backgrounds meet monthly for boardroom-style classes that cultivate a collaborative learning environment paired with a stimulating academic curriculum fostered by our world-class faculty. About the Fortune Ranking

This is the first EMBA ranking by Fortune (methodology here). Fortune invited schools to participate in the first-ever Best Executive MBA Programs ranking. That information, along with data collected from companies and executives, was used to build the ranking. The final ranking is made up of three components: Program Score, Brand Score, and Fortune 1000 Score. The Fortune rankings are available here.
